Beginning April 1st, we will share with you free patterns from some of our favorite designers to complete a Christmas quilt. Each week, one designer will post the free pattern on their website. All you need to do is go to the website on the date indicated below to download and print your free pattern and order kits to complete the block. Printed patterns will be available to purchase for those of you that can’t download the free pattern.
